Arise and Eat

In our journey with Christ we sometimes get weary, discouraged or even depressed. We see this in the life of Elijah the Prophet but we also see God's fix. First, we must guard our hearts from self-righteousness, complacency and self-deception. Then, we must recognize that our strength comes from our continual abiding relationship with Jesus.

The Humility of God

During the Christmas season we are reminded of the amazing humility of God, though He was equal with God, Jesus humbled Himself and took on the form of a servant. He did this because God has always desired to have fellowship with us. Consider the great lengths God has gone to and continues to go to, in order to have fellowship with us!!

God's Cure For Worry

In telling the parable of the sower, Jesus warns that the care (worry & anxiety) of this world can choke out the effectiveness of God's word. Throughout scripture we are told not to worry and never allow fear to control our heart. God's cure for fear is keeping our eyes on Jesus, prayer and guarding what we allow into our minds. Be anxious for nothing!!

Gods Cure for Bad Decisions

We have all made bad decisions. These decisions often have consequences that not only affect us but those around us. Fortunately, one of the great privileges of being a Christian is that God's spirit will lead us. Sadly, too many choose to neglect God's guidance in "all things" and end up leaning on their own understanding. God's cure for bad decisions is His spirit & wisdom!
